Psychological Perspectives in Education and Primary Care (PPEPCare) has been designed to help staff in primary care education and other professionals to recognise and understand mental health difficulties in children and young people and offer appropriate support and guidance to children, young people and their families using psycho-education and evidenced psychological techniques such as using a cognitive behavioural framework.
What eating disorders are and how they might present. Guidance around how to explore difficulties and risks in this area, and useful questions to ask young people. The importance of referral to specialist services in Berkshire and what treatment might look like in this setting.
